I'm trying to locate the names of the parents of my paternal grandfather, Luigi (Louis) Vincenzo (or Vinanzio) Rainaldi, born 3 May 1882, in Pescocostanzo, L'Aquila, Abruzzo. He had a brother Joseph, also possibly known as Alessandro. Family stories say his mother's maiden name may have been Tollis.

I have history in the US from his arrival at age 16 through his death, but am having trouble identifying his parents in Pescocostanza. Records for Pescocostanza are missing for the period of his birth. I do use the FHC and have all the Pescocostanza films on permanent loan.

I've just written to the Diocese of Pgh, hoping they may have some info from wedding or children's births identifying his parents. He also returned to Italy to pick up a cousin in 1906 and was transcripted into the Italian army on his arrival and was unable to return until 1907. I don't know if there might be other records in Italy other than the Pescocostanza records. His passport application does not list a father's name. I've gone back 5 generations on my family research on all lines but this one. Any ideas about how I might continue my research would be appreciated.

You say you have US records "through his death". Would that include his Social Security Death Index? Using his SS # you can request his Social Security Application (I think it is SS-5). That will have his parents' names.
